Hello again! Today we will be reading from the 7th chapter of the book of John verses 1 to 10. This is the story of Jesus healing the centurion’s servant. First off, a centurion was a local military commander in the days of Christ. He would have been very wealthy and powerful in his area of rule. This centurion was very different from most of his time because in verse 5 you see that he loved the Jews and he had built them a synagogue. Moreover, he actually cared about the health of one of his servants. Well this servant of his became sick and when the centurion heard about Jesus, he sent the elders of the Jews to go and ask Jesus to come. So Jesus begins on His way to the centurion’s house, but when Jesus is almost there the centurion sent out some of his friends to meet Jesus. They told Jesus that the centurion said he was not worthy of having Jesus enter his home and that he didn’t want to trouble Jesus with the rest of the trip. They then told Jesus that all the centurion asked was that He speak the word, for he knew that at Jesus’ command the servant would be healed. The centurion was a man of power and he knew that when he told his men to do something that they did it. Whether he was there are not, his soldiers and servants followed his command. The centurion also knew that Jesus was in command of powers far greater than the Roman army, and all Jesus needed to do was to command the healing and it would take place no matter where Jesus was. So Jesus healed the servant and in verse 9 Jesus said He had not seen such great faith even in Israel. Now, what is all of this saying? Hello everyone. Today I want to talk to you for a few minutes about how God puts us through tests to see if we will continue to serve Him. There are many stories in the Bible about God testing His servants, and I have chosen to look at the story of Joseph’s life. Genesis chapter 37 to chapter 50 tells a every long story about many different parts of Joseph’s life. I will spare you the story, and you can read it for yourself if you don’t already know it. Joseph had some dreams as a young man and God showed him some things that he didn’t fully understand. The dreams were about the future and what God was calling him to do. Joseph had a great future ahead of him in God, but God was not going to just give that position to Joseph without a test. Joseph was sold into slavery by his brothers and they told his father Jacob that Joseph had been killed. So now Joseph is a slave and in his slavery he continued to hold onto God. While he was a slave he was put in prison for something he didn’t do. Most people would think that that is a good reason to give up on God, but Joseph stood strong. In the end, Joseph was the second most powerful man in Egypt, and God had fulfilled the visions of Joseph’s youth. Hello everyone, and thanks for coming. Today we will be reading from the book of Acts chapter 4 verses 10 – 12. The verses say “(10) Be it known unto you all, and to all the people of Israel, that by the name of Jesus Christ of Nazareth, whom ye crucified, whom God raised from the dead, even by him doth this man stand before you whole. (11) This is THE STONE WHICH WAS SET AT NAUGHT OF YOU BUILDERS, WHICH IS BECOME THE HEAD OF THE CORNER. (12) Neither is there salvation in any other: for there is none other name under heaven given among men, whereby we must be saved.” So, what do we have here? Well I think it is certain that Peter wants us to know that Jesus is the only way to be saved. In the 10th verse he is saying how the reason he was made whole was because of Jesus’ being raised from the dead. When Jesus gave His life He paid the price for everyone’s sin, and when Peter asked the Lord to forgive him of sin the blood of Jesus made him whole. In the Old Testament the Spirit of the Lord didn’t live in the hearts of men, so even if they followed God there was an empty part in there life. Well when Jesus sacrificed Himself, He sent His Spirit to comfort us and that Spirit fills the gap in our lives and makes us whole. The 11th verse is in reference to a verse in Isaiah 28:16. Jesus was said to be the corner stone and foundation of what God was going to do. Well Peter is telling the rulers, elders, and scribes he had gathered there that when they rejected Jesus that they were rejecting what God was going to build up. The stone they rejected was the precious corner stone that God was going to use to build His church. A corner stone was the first thing they laid down when building, and everything else was measured outward from that stone. In verse 12, Peter is very simple in what he says.
